Three migrants are rescued from a small boat while trying to cross the Channel on New Year’s Day

Three migrants have been rescued from a small boat while attempting to cross the freezing Channel to Britain on New Year’s day. The asylum seekers – one suffering from hypothermia – were rescued by a French customs ship and taken to coastal town Boulogne-sur-Mer.
